The Basics:

At its core, an electrical wire connector is a device that joins two or more electrical conductors, allowing the uninterrupted transmission of electrical signals or power. These connectors come in various shapes and sizes, designed to meet specific needs in diverse electrical systems. The primary function of electrical wire connectors is to establish a secure and reliable connection, preventing signal loss, power dissipation, or potential hazards like short circuits.

The Role of Innovation:

As technology advances, so does the innovation in electrical wire connectors. Manufacturers are continually developing connectors with enhanced features, such as quick-connect mechanisms, corrosion resistance, and compatibility with diverse wire types. These advancements not only improve the efficiency of electrical systems but also contribute to overall safety and longevity.

Challenges and Considerations:

While electrical wire connectors are fundamental to our interconnected world, challenges persist. One of the key concerns is compatibility – ensuring that connectors are suitable for the specific wires, voltages, and environmental conditions they will encounter. Additionally, issues like corrosion, improper installation, and substandard materials can compromise the integrity of connections, leading to potential hazards.
